Shafter High Judging Teams Sweep Contests at Pomona Fair

Shafter high school judging team swept nearly all prizes at the Southern California Fair in Pomona. Wilmer Enns led in milk and butter scoring, Victor Voth topped in cheese, with Enns and Neuman placing high in overall individual scores. The team earned the sweepstakes trophy and four target cups, edging Tranquility and Santa Maria in the field.

Attendant Suspended in Sonoma Case

Harry Lutyens, director of state institutions, suspended Sonoma attendant George West for 30 days without pay on charges of kicking or striking 14 year old Joseph Sanchez and forcing the boy to clean his shoes.

Kern County to Hold Third Annual Cotton Picking Contest

The Kern County Farm Bureau sponsors the third annual cotton picking contest to be held Thursday October 15 in a field to be chosen in Bakersfield. Entrants must have picked at least 600 pounds in one day, with past records noted by Luis Cantanda and Ed Murdoch as organizers and judges allocating prizes and wages.

Fatal grade crossing crash claims Wasco AC worker wife

Mrs. James Williams 25 wife of a Wasco Creamery employee was killed when the Grand Canyon Limited northbound train struck her stalled car at a grade crossing a mile east of Wasco. The car was wrecked, the locomotive damaged, and the train needed a second engine to proceed. An inquest was held at Janzen Funeral Home in Shafer.

Permits Not Required After School Hours

County child welfare director W. Byfield clarifies that no working permits are required for children or domestic labor. He asks The Press to publish this fact after reports that ranchers refused hires without permits. Children aged 8 to 18 working during school hours must have permits.

Cotton Thefts Land Two In County Jail

Isaiah Davis is serving a 60 day sentence in the county jail for cotton thefts. His alleged partner Jack Freeman awaits trial on two counts of petit theft. They are accused of stealing wagon loads of loose cotton from Buelah Hart in Fairfax road and Leonard Keele in Greenfield and of obtaining two checks for 66 dollars and 78 dollars.
